Iran issues fatwa against Donald Trump: "Enemy of God"
A senior cleric in Iran has issued a fatwa declaring that anyone who threatens Iran's Supreme Le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ei is "an enemy of God," state media has reported.
Grand Ayatollah Naser Makarem Shirazi was responding to a question about any threats made by U.S. President Donald Trump and the leaders of Israel, including prime minister Benjamin Netanyahu.
A fatwa is a ruling on how to interpret Islamic law issued by a clerical authority.

The thing I found out when I was a manager is you will get exactly what you measure. If you measure how long it takes to close tickets your customer service will suffer (that's a stupid thing to measure anyway, but we had a stupid director). If you measure the number of tickets closed then you'll get each step of a process as a ticket. If you measure billable hours you'll get a bunch of time padding.
So since the religion is measuring the amount of sin and (in some denominations cases) good works performed, that's what you'll get. How many of the big 10 did you stay on the right side of? Did you put in 2 hours at the soup kitchen? Cool, here's your ticket to heaven. It's not measuring how good you are to your fellow humans.
